This desk was really fun for me to build and taught me a lot of woodworking and epoxy-making skills. It started off inspired by Lichtenberg burn projects and epoxy river projects and then I decided that I also wanted to add lights. The base wood was butcher block, nice plywood, and some 2x4s. The process was as follows:
I modeled this desk in blender then cut, sanded, and screw the boards for the desk together. I also used a neon sign transformer to burn Lichtenberg burns into the surface. I then added channels and slid the LED's in the channels. I caulked and epoxied the river and the Lichtenberg burns. The Last thing I did was some cleanup of the epoxy because I had some leaks in the caulk I didn't find that created some drips and other things.
